this one’s super shameful.

encryption was rolled out because 2020 activists learned how to listen to their scanners to know when SRG would be showing up to beat them up, and NYPD disliked that.

the only actual impact this has is preventing news teams from being able to report on emergencies.
Among the bills vetoed by Gov Hochul in the close of the year,

the "Keep police radio public act," which would have ensured that police dispatch radio remained audible to the press.

Encrypted radio communications make it much harder for the press to keep law enforcement accountable.
Here's Every Bill That Kathy Hochul Vetoed in 2025
One hundred and forty laws that almost were.
